**Ticket: Vault locked — stringharvest extraction script blocked**

Welcome aboard. The Lexiqo vault holding credentials for our stringharvest script (pulls translation keys from the Fenwick UI repo) auto-sealed after three failed unseal attempts last Tuesday. Until it's reopened, nightly extraction runs will fail silently, so don't trust the localization diffs. Standard unseal keys were rotated out in the Marlowe migration, so the normal path won't work. Use the recovery passphrase below to unseal and resume the job.

unlock words, fadug-tageg: zorix-wenwyn-quenmir

# Plumbline Environments: Report Exports

All report exports render timestamps in UTC, regardless of the requesting user's locale. Conversion happens client-side only. Staging mimics prod except the scheduler runs hourly, not nightly. Do not change the export worker's zone setting manually; it drifts the cache keys. If a client complains about shifted dates, check their profile zone first. The relevant environment settings are listed below.

settings of fafog-haduf:
ZORIX_PIN=4648
ZORIX_METRICS_HOST=metrics.zorix.paliqsys.corp
ZORIX_LOG_LEVEL=info
ZORIX_TENANT=druix

CI NOTE — Stale-cache postmortem (Lanternjar pipeline). The March incident happened because the dependency cache key omitted the lockfile hash, so stale artifacts survived across branches. The key now includes the lockfile digest plus the runner image tag. As a new contractor, never restore caches manually on the Fenwick runners. If you suspect staleness again, purge and rebuild, then attach the fresh build token shown below.

pipeline stamp: htk31_f769b577b3028a4e9958e5bb8d1259a

**Action item — build agent clock skew (Ostermill CI outage).** During the incident, artifact timestamps from agents in the Verlan pool drifted several minutes apart, causing the cache layer to treat fresh builds as stale. Going forward, every agent must sync against the internal time service at boot and hourly thereafter, with skew checks gating job pickup. The enforced skew thresholds and sync intervals are as follows.

constants for bawif-kawif:
QUOTAS = {
    "ulaael": 5,
    "holael": 10,
}